Output 51b3c3965be78e9143a02a4f99ae0615b86f6dbdeeb0a8ded0aa9c7578580221:0

value
3741869
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 234e51e22267cef9e1ce4bfe46e93c808bc73102 OP_EQUALVERIFY OP_CHECKSIG
address
14DgUUSZMa4GuzVHhViHN9nb6EgJhjdnNH
transaction
51b3c3965be78e9143a02a4f99ae0615b86f6dbdeeb0a8ded0aa9c7578580221
spent
true